Summer Science with Steve Holst!

Wonders of Science Summer Camps

 We had such a great time last year with a camp for 6-13 year olds that we are adding a camp for older students, or for those who are ready for more challenging labs, yet still with tons of fun demonstrations.  

Science Camp 1 is much of the same material we covered last year - Polymers, Density, Atomic Structure and Chemistry, Air Pressure/Flight and Rockets.  

Science Camp 2 (ages 10-15)  will have topics such as Chemistry, Geology, Biology, Light/Electricity and Magnetism, and Physics.  Our last day will be spent assembling and then firing off C-engine rockets.  

Each camp is filled with exciting  demonstrations and hands-on science. 

The location will again be Madrone Trail Charter School on Ross Lane in Medford for the week of June 16 - 20th.   If there is enough interest in Grants Pass we would love to do a camp there sometime in July, but right now are not planning on it.  You can find more info at the website -www.livingwatershomeschoolcourses.com

Our goal with the camps is to light a fire in the hearts of children to delight in studying God's creation.  Let me know if you have any questions.

Volunteers Needed for Sometimes Miracles Hide

VOLUNTEER INFORMATION: Please call (541) 535-8479 or email rachelolstad@gmail.com for more information or to volunteer.

SOMETIMES MIRACLES HIDE
Saturday, May 17, 2014
10:30 am-2:15 pm
First Baptist Church
Medford, OR

Sometimes Miracles Hide is a luncheon and carnival for mothers and their children with special needs. While moms enjoy a delicious meal and an inspirational program, their children, who are paired with a buddy, are treated to a carnival filled with games and activities.

Over 200 volunteers are needs to be buddies, assist in the kitchen, work in the nursery, serve tables and lots more! Training is provided (10:30 a.m. the day of the event) and you will receive many blessings for serving.
